Nergens thuis tussen Goeree en de Oost


Nergens thuis tussen Goeree en de Oost

Author: Anthonie Heidinga

language: nl

Publisher: Uitgeverij Verloren

Release Date: 2022-03-22


DOWNLOAD





De zeeofficier Adriaan Goekoop (1871-1912), telg uit een Goerees herenboerengeslacht, deed iets wat achteraf van aanzienlijk historisch belang is: hij schreef brieven. Levendige brieven aan zijn familie in Goedereede over zijn belevenissen en de vreemde, mooie maar vaak ook gruwelijke wereld waarin hij verzeild raakte. Behalve de brieven heeft Goekoop tal van foto’s nagelaten die zijn tochten over de aardbol prachtig illustreren. Nederland vocht toen in wat Nederlands-Indië heette een vuile koloniale oorlog uit. Goekoop was daarvan niet alleen getuige maar speelde zelf een belangrijke rol bij enkele cruciale acties. Vooral de ‘Indische’ brieven zijn een belangrijke aanvulling op ons begrip van deze fase van de koloniale geschiedenis en van het Indië van deze tijd.

Relationships Rights and Legal Pluralism


Relationships Rights and Legal Pluralism

Author: Mateusz Stępień

language: en

Publisher: Taylor & Francis

Release Date: 2024-08-01


DOWNLOAD





This interdisciplinary book brings together leading social and legal scholars to tackle the incompatibility of marriage laws with contemporary social reality in Europe. Their critique is based on the assumption that individuals should be able to choose how they organise their close relationships. The contributors emphasise the importance of pluralism of beliefs, values, cultures, and lifestyles and the consequent need for legal recognition to make individuals' private choices valid and respected. The first part of the book establishes the foundation for the subsequent chapters by exploring the advantages and challenges of focusing on values while accommodating relationship design plurality, the impact of the European Court of Human Rights on the issue, and the transformation of the institution of marriage. The second part presents different legal responses to non-state marriages, particularly religious marriages among Muslim communities, and proposals for reform. The third part of the book features empirical research on the marital experiences of two communities: Muslims and migrants. The chapters concentrate on polygyny among female converts to Islam, the importance of religious knowledge for practising Muslim women in securing rights in their marital relationships, transnational and interreligious marriages, and the impact of acculturative orientation and position in the dual labour market on the choice of life partner among Polish migrant women. The book will be of interest to academics, researchers, and policymakers working in the areas of human rights law, family law, legal anthropology, law and religion, socio-legal studies, feminism and queer studies, and sociology of family.

Religious Ideas in Liberal Democratic States


Religious Ideas in Liberal Democratic States

Author: Jasper Doomen

language: en

Publisher: Bloomsbury Publishing USA

Release Date: 2021-07-29


DOWNLOAD





Religious Ideas in Liberal Democratic States adds new context to the ongoing debate over the scope of religious freedom, drawing from a variety of perspectives to discuss the meaning of religion itself within a democratic state. This book argues that categorizing religion as a solely private affair is too narrow an interpretation and questions whether ideas like freedom, human dignity, and equality can be truly actualized in a neutral and secular state. Contributors explore the impact of religion, acknowledged or not, on legislation, human rights, and group rights through legal, historical, and sociological lenses. Scholars of constitutional law, jurisprudence, international law, and political science will find this book particularly useful.
